Misconceptions that shape how people approach OKX sign in
Misconception 1: „If I can create a wallet, I can use the exchange from the U.S.“ Not true. OKX operates a web3 wallet that is non-custodial and multi-chain, but the centralized exchange portion enforces geographic restrictions. Residents of the United States cannot use the OKX exchange services; the platform is explicitly unavailable to U.S. residents. That means even if you can install the OKX Web3 Wallet client and generate keys locally, exchange account functions — deposits, spot trading, derivatives, and Earn products tied to the CEX — remain restricted for U.S. customers.
Misconception 2: „Signing in equals custody of assets.“ Signing in to OKX’s centralized platform gives you an account with custodial controls: the exchange stores private keys for assets you deposit on its order books or in its custodial wallets. Separately, OKX offers an integrated non-custodial Web3 Wallet (a different product flow) where you control keys locally. Confusing these two increases operational risk: users who assume custodial protections carry over to non-custodial tools — or vice versa — may misuse features like staking, lending, or transfer approvals.
How the sign-in flow reflects OKX’s architecture and choices
Mechanism matters. The sign-in page is the gateway that establishes identity and then maps you into either custodial exchange services or the browser/mobile wallet environment. For advanced traders this matters for three practical reasons: access to APIs for automation, access to Earn and staking products, and withdrawal limits tied to KYC status.
First, API access: OKX exposes REST and WebSocket APIs that permit algorithmic trading, order routing, and real-time market data. Those credentials are tied to your verified account, and many traders deploy native bots (grid trading, DCA, arbitrage) that depend on API keys generated after sign-in. Precise permissioning of API keys — restricting withdrawals, setting IP whitelists, using HMAC signing — is a crucial defensive step once you’re authenticated.
Second, Earn and staking: OKX Earn and on-platform staking products are managed within the custodial environment. Features like locking funds into fixed-term savings, participating in PoS staking pools, or engaging in DeFi yield farming offered through the exchange require both an active account and KYC to unlock higher limits. The sign-in step determines whether you can access these income streams and what limits will apply.
Third, KYC and withdrawal caps: OKX enforces mandatory Know Your Customer (KYC) processes aligned with AML rules. Basic sign-in without verified KYC will leave you with limited deposit and withdrawal ceilings. Completing ID and proof-of-address verification expands those limits but also attaches your identity to on-chain flows and internal records. That trade-off — convenience and higher limits versus privacy — is deliberate and legally motivated.
Where the sign-in experience can break and how to mitigate it
Breakage often stems from three sources: regional blocks, 2FA/account recovery failures, and API misconfiguration. Regional blocks are binary: if your registered residence is in a prohibited jurisdiction (notably the U.S.), the exchange will block or disable key services. A practical mitigation is to not attempt to circumvent geographic rules; doing so exposes you to account freezes and fund recovery disputes.
Two-factor authentication (2FA) protects withdrawals but can also become the single point of failure in account recovery. Best practices: use an authenticator app rather than SMS; register backup codes and export encrypted copies of recovery seeds; keep the device and recovery methods separate from your primary trading workstation. For teams or institutional setups, hardware security modules and multi-user approvals via API key management reduce single-person failure modes.
API misconfiguration—especially granting withdrawal privileges to programmatic keys—has repeatedly cost traders funds elsewhere in the industry. Always create API keys with the minimum necessary scopes (view-only, trade-only) and apply IP whitelists. If you use native trading bots, test extensively in sandbox or low-risk environments before scaling positions.
Practical decision framework: when to use OKX, when not to
Heuristic 1 — Use OKX if: you need wide altcoin coverage (350+ tokens, 1,000+ trading pairs), deep order books to minimize slippage, or advanced derivatives (perpetuals with high leverage, options with Greeks). OKX’s Proof of Reserves and cold-storage architecture make it a reasonable custodial choice for traders who prioritize liquidity and product breadth.
Heuristic 2 — Avoid OKX for exchange trading if: you are a U.S. resident, value regulatory residency in a U.S.-regulated venue, or require guaranteed fiat on-ramps tied to U.S. banks. OKX enforces geographic restrictions and exited mainland China in 2021; regulatory posture changes are possible, but for now the U.S. market is out of scope for its CEX offerings.
Heuristic 3 — Use the OKX Web3 Wallet when you need self-custody across chains (Ethereum, BNB, Solana, Polygon, OKC) and want to sign contracts directly from your device. Remember that non-custodial wallets shift all responsibility for key management to you — loss of seed phrase equals loss of funds without recourse.

FAQ
Can I sign in to OKX from the U.S. if I use a VPN?
Short answer: you should not try to circumvent geographic restrictions. Using a VPN to appear in another country is against terms of service and risks account suspension, fund freezes, and difficulty with legitimate recovery. The correct path is to choose an exchange licensed to serve U.S. residents.
Is the OKX Web3 Wallet the same as signing in to the exchange?
No. The Web3 Wallet is non-custodial: you control private keys locally and it supports many blockchains. Signing in to the OKX centralized exchange creates a custodial account with different protections, KYC requirements, and product access. Treat them as distinct products with distinct risk models.
What happens if I lose access to my 2FA after I sign in?
Account recovery typically requires identity verification and can be time-consuming. To reduce risk, keep backup codes, use an authenticator app with exportable encrypted backups, and consider hardware security keys where supported. For institutional accounts, multi-user approvals and HSM-backed key stores are stronger options.
Does OKX publish proof that customer funds are backed?
Yes. OKX publishes Proof of Reserves using Merkle Tree cryptographic audits so users can independently verify exchange-backed assets. That improves transparency but is not an insurance policy — it shows reserves at a point in time and depends on correct audit implementation.
